Как подключиться к VDS по SSH
В современном мире, где виртуальные серверы (VDS) стали неотъемлемой частью нашей цифровой жизни, умение управлять ими дистанционно — ценный навык. 🔑 И одним из наиболее распространенных и надежных способов доступа к VDS является SSH-соединение. 🚀
- Что такое SSH
- Как подключиться к VDS по SSH
- Несколько важных моментов
- Подключение к VDS через SSH: детальное руководство
- Советы по работе с SSH
- Заключение
- FAQ
Что такое SSH
SSH (Secure Shell) — это протокол, который обеспечивает безопасное и зашифрованное соединение между вашим компьютером и удаленным сервером. 🔐 Используя SSH, вы можете получить доступ к командной строке сервера, запускать программы, управлять файлами и выполнять другие операции, как будто вы сидите непосредственно перед ним. 🧑💻
Как подключиться к VDS по SSH
Подключение к VDS через SSH — это несложный процесс, который можно выполнить всего за несколько шагов:
- Выберите SSH-клиент.
- Для Windows: PuTTY — бесплатный и популярный SSH-клиент.
- Для macOS и Linux: встроенные утилиты Terminal или iTerm2.
- Получите данные для подключения.
- IP-адрес: это адрес вашего VDS, который вы найдете в панели управления хостинга.
- Имя пользователя: обычно это "root" или "admin", но может быть и другое имя, которое вам предоставил ваш хостинг-провайдер.
- Пароль: для входа в систему.
- Запустите SSH-клиент.
- Введите IP-адрес в поле «Имя хоста» или «Адрес» в зависимости от вашего SSH-клиента.
- Введите имя пользователя в соответствующем поле.
- Нажмите «Подключить» или "Enter".
- Введите пароль.
- В появившемся окне введите пароль, который вы получили от хостинг-провайдера.
- Готово! Вы успешно подключились к своему VDS через SSH.
Несколько важных моментов
- Безопасность: Используйте надежные пароли и, если возможно, включите двухфакторную аутентификацию для дополнительной защиты. 🔐
- Ключевая пара SSH: Более продвинутый способ аутентификации, который позволяет избежать ввода пароля каждый раз. 🔑
- Порт SSH: По умолчанию SSH-соединение устанавливается на порт 22, но ваш хостинг-провайдер может использовать другой порт.
- Дополнительные команды SSH:
ssh -p 2222 user@server.com
— подключение на порт 2222.ssh -i key.pem user@server.com
— подключение с использованием SSH-ключа.
Подключение к VDS через SSH: детальное руководство
1. Выбор SSH-клиента:- PuTTY (Windows):
- Бесплатный SSH-клиент с широкими возможностями.
- Простой в использовании, поддерживает множество функций, включая перенаправление портов и туннелирование.
- Скачать PuTTY можно с официального сайта https://www.chiark.greenend.org.uk/~sgtatham/putty/.
- Terminal (macOS и Linux):
- Встроенный SSH-клиент в операционных системах macOS и Linux.
- Простой в использовании, обладает базовыми функциями SSH.
- Для подключения введите команду
ssh user@server.com
. - iTerm2 (macOS):
- Популярный SSH-клиент для macOS с расширенными функциями.
- Поддерживает табы, разделение окна, горячие клавиши и многое другое.
- Скачать iTerm2 можно с официального сайта https://iterm2.com/.
- IP-адрес:
- Обычно предоставляется хостинг-провайдером.
- Можно найти в панели управления хостинга.
- В некоторых случаях IP-адрес может меняться.
- Имя пользователя:
- Обычно "root" или "admin".
- Проверьте информацию, предоставленную хостинг-провайдером.
- Пароль:
- Предоставляется хостинг-провайдером при создании VDS.
- Храните пароль в надежном месте и не делитесь им с другими.
- PuTTY:
- Откройте PuTTY.
- Введите IP-адрес VDS в поле «Имя хоста».
- Выберите "SSH" в поле «Тип соединения».
- Введите имя пользователя в поле «Имя пользователя».
- Нажмите «Открыть».
- Terminal (macOS и Linux):
- Откройте Terminal.
- Введите команду
ssh user@server.com
. - Замените
user
на имя пользователя иserver.com
на IP-адрес VDS. - Нажмите "Enter".
- iTerm2:
- Откройте iTerm2.
- Введите команду
ssh user@server.com
. - Замените
user
на имя пользователя иserver.com
на IP-адрес VDS. - Нажмите "Enter".
- Введите пароль в появившемся окне.
- Нажмите "Enter".
- После успешного ввода пароля вы увидите командную строку VDS.
- Теперь вы можете использовать команды для управления VDS.
Советы по работе с SSH
- Используйте надежные пароли.
- Включите двухфакторную аутентификацию.
- Создайте SSH-ключевую пару для более безопасного подключения.
- Используйте SSH-агент для автоматического хранения ключей.
- Создайте SSH-туннель для безопасного доступа к удаленным ресурсам.
- Проверьте журнал SSH для отслеживания активности.
Заключение
SSH — это мощный инструмент для управления VDS, который предоставляет безопасный и удобный доступ к удаленным серверам. 💻 Используя SSH, вы можете выполнять множество задач, от установки программного обеспечения до настройки веб-сайтов. 🌐
FAQ
- Что делать, если я забыл пароль от VDS?
- Свяжитесь с вашим хостинг-провайдером для сброса пароля.
- Как подключиться к VDS через SSH без пароля?
- Используйте SSH-ключевую пару.
- Как проверить, подключен ли я к VDS через SSH?
- Введите команду
whoami
в командной строке VDS. - Как отключиться от VDS через SSH?
- Введите команду
exit
в командной строке VDS. - Какие команды SSH наиболее полезны?
ls
— просмотр файлов и папок.cd
— смена директории.mkdir
— создание директории.rm
— удаление файлов и папок.sudo
— выполнение команд с правами администратора.- Как узнать IP-адрес своего VDS?
- Проверьте информацию в панели управления хостинга.
- Как настроить SSH-соединение на порт 2222?
- Используйте команду
ssh -p 2222 user@server.com
. - Как настроить SSH-соединение с использованием SSH-ключа?
- Используйте команду
ssh -i key.pem user@server.com
.